Yes when the subsidies do kick in, you would assume Lynas would benefit by being able to command better prices than those manipulated by the chinese. In the meantime though, Lynas is stuck with chinese pricing. Whatever happened to rest of world being happy to pay for environmentally responsible and sustainable production? Do all those certifications mean nothing? My frustration is at Lynas' inability to convert these advantages into sustainable pricing at this moment. Lynas claims the only way is by establishing critical mass, more outside supply. In the meantime it's China Northern, or in other words, the Chinese govt calling the shots. It benefits them to keep prices low for the sake of their industry and it allows them to continue to import rare earths cheaply from MP and others.
